The Cibola Raiders will venture away from home to challenge the Westwood Warriors at 3:45 p.m. on Wednesday. Both squads will be entering this one on the heels of a big victory.
Cibola barely beat Gila Ridge the last time the pair played, but that sure wasn't the case this time around. The Raiders were the clear victors by a 7-1 margin over the Hawks on Tuesday.
Isaac Lopez sp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ered only one earned run on six hits. He has been consistent : he hasn't given up more than one earned run in six consecutive appearances.
On the hitting side, Cibola got a big performance out of Rodrigo Orozco Araiza, who scored two runs and stole a base while going 3-for-3. Alfredo Lugo was another key player, going 2-for-4 with three RBI and one stolen base.
Cibola always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.516.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Gila Ridge only posted an OBP of .231.
Meanwhile, Westwood can bid farewell to their three-game losing streak thanks to their game on Monday. Everything went their way against Dobson as they made off with an 11-1 win. The high-scoring effort was just what the Warriors needed considering they were shut out in their previous contest.
Cibola's record is now 10-7. As for Westwood, their record now sits at 14-9.
